OTT releases this week

Ironheart - (June 25, JioHotstar)

Genius teenage inventor Riri Williams creates the most advanced suit of armour since Iron Man

The Bear season 4 (June 26, JioHotstar)

Following a Chicago Tribune review threatening the restaurant’s future, Jeremy Allen White as Chef Carmy must navigate personal and professional crises. This season continues the mix of kitchen chaos, emotional depth, and tense drama that defines the series

The Gilded Age Season 3 - (June 23, JioHotstar)

Marian Brook, a rural girl, moves to New York after her father's death. However, things get complicated when she must assimilate into the clan of a railroad tycoon

Countdown (June 25, Amazon Prime Video)

Starring  Jensen Ackles as an LAPD detective, the story revolves around a Homeland Security agent’s daylight murder, which prompts the formation of a secret multi-agency task force. What starts as a whodunit escalates into a far-reaching conspiracy putting millions at risk

Raid 2 (June 27, Netflix) 

A Income Tax officer, Amay Patnaik, confronts the corrupt nexus in Bhoj. Beneath the veneer of honesty lies a sinister operation tied to Dada Bhai, a revered politician. As Amay unravels layers of deceit buried in fields and fortresses, one question looms: will justice prevail, or will power silence the truth?

Oka Padhakam Prakaram (June 27, JioHotstar)

After losing everything and his wife's disappearance, Siddharth faces arrest. While investigating, he uncovers widespread societal crimes and vulnerabilities

The Brutalist (June 28, JioHotstar)

Escaping postwar Europe, a visionary architect comes to America to rebuild his life, his career, and his marriage. On his own in a strange new country, he settles in Pennsylvania, where a wealthy and prominent industrialist recognises his talent

Mistry (June 27, JioHotstar)

An official Indian spin on Monk, set in Mumbai. Ram Kapoor as Armaan Mistry uses his obsessive attention to detail to help solve tough cases, consulting for the Mumbai Police. Expect a mix of crime-solving, character-driven drama, and gentle humour

Panchayat season 4 (June 24, Amazon Prime Video)

This season centers on the village panchayat election battle between Neena Gupta as Manju Devi and Sunita Rajwar as Kranti Devi. The series is already out; some say it lacks the spark of earlier seasons

Viraatapalem: PC Meena Reporting - (June 27, ZEE5)

With superstition, suspense, and a powerful message at its core, ‘Viraatapalem: PC Meena Reporting’ is not just a Supernatural Thriller, it’s a battle between fear and truth, unfolding in the most unexpected of places

Squid Game season 3 (June 27, Netflix)

Picking up directly after Season 2’s cliffhanger, Lee Jung-jae as Gi-hun in Squid Game season 3 is mentally shattered and pulled back into the deadly games. Expect increasingly brutal challenges—new games, VIP spectators, moral dilemmas, and high-stakes rebellion
